    One of the reasons why the English players are not up to the mark....is the different systems they are made to play. When the clubs decide to play defensively, the players are not allowed to develop their flare. With clubs constantly changing their style is it any wonder that the English coach who has yet another style of play has problems.
    Look at any of our main rivals in the footballing world....The Dutch are probably the best example. Their style of play does not alter that much all through their leagues, yes tactically their game does change a bit but not to such a large degree. In other words their development strategy over the footballers career is pretty much the same all the way through, unlike our players. Well at least that is my opinion.

    I watched Spain last night, and I won't do it again. Why? Because it's utterly depressing that the teams I support (Liverpool and England) will definitely never play to that standard for the rest of my life. The problem is not with PL teams buying foreign, (they buy foreign because English players are not that good and aren't value for money), it is with the FA and coaches. Germany , Italy and Spain have 10x more football coaches than we do, and they are to a higher standard. Players are taught how to play with the ball, not play without it. It will take years to undo the mess English football finds itself in, and it needs to start from the ground up and at schools, no point trying to teach our current players new tricks.
